Club History: Staff of the State Revenue Office (SRO) formed Five-O-Five Toastmasters Club in 1996 to provide opportunities for staff in the organization to improve their speaking skills and warmly welcomed members from outside the SRO. The club was officially charted in June 1996 as part of Toastmasters International. The name Five-O-Five was taken from the then location of the SRO at 505 Little Collins Street. When the SRO moved to 121 Exhibition Street we retained the original name as the Club had 10 years of history under that name.

Five-O-Five meets 1st & 3rd Wednesday of the month at lunch time and provides an opportunity for members to practice the key skills of a competent communicator. The club is open to all interested parties and we have a mix of new members and experienced members. Our focus as a club is on encouraging members to exceed their expectations and to expand their horizons by achieving their full potential as communicators and leaders.

Five-O-Five is a member of Toastmasters International which is a non-profit organisation that provides a vast number of resources to develop public speakers and presenters from novices to professionals. The mission of all clubs is to “provide a mutually supportive and positive learning environment in which every member has the opportunity to develop communication and leadership skills, which in turn foster self-confidence and personal growth.”
